应对巨大地震的应急流动观测系统

摘    要:通过“十五”数字地震观测网络项目建设,目前。我国的地震观测系统和地震观测信号传输几乎完全依赖于公共通讯网络。但是,大地震常常严重破坏公共通讯系统,应对巨大地震的流动观测系统就提到迫切的日程。2007年,通过采用无线竞带接入技术,结合中国地震局数字地震观测网络技术,初步建成了应对巨大地震的应急流动观测系统,并在汶川地震现场观测初期发挥了重要作用。

An emergency mobile observation system for great earthquake

Abstract:At present, the seismological observation and signal transmission system in China almost depends on the public communication network by the construction of digital seismological observation network during the tenth five-year plan. However, the public communication system is usually damaged seriously after a great earthquake and thus a mobile emergency observation system for great earthquakes need to be developed urgently. The emergency mobile observation system for great earthquakes developed since 2007 is based on wireless broad-band access technology and also combined with the technology of the digital seismic network. This system had played an important role at the early days during field seismological observation for Wenchuan great earthquake.
